One part of the house that can be the favorite of any person is the bedroom. It is your space wherein you can call it your own. When you want solace, you can own the place. The best part is it is where your bed is located. After all in a days work, you will be glad to see this room, as every comfort that you are looking for sleep can be found in here.

This may not be the place where you usually dwell when you are at home but this is room is not exempted from being decorated. Your room, just like the other parts of your house, can give you that serenity that you are looking for. Everyone wants to go home in a house where everything that is seen is pleasant to the eye.

Here are some few tips on how to beautify your own room:

We all want comfort in our bedrooms. Therefore, find a bed that has a cushion with the right softness. Also, make sure that the bed that you have fits your size. Nevertheless, to make it more inviting for sleep, select linens that are not rough and can keep you warm on a cold night.

Your walls can be decorated beautifully with photos or anything that reminds you of home. However, it you can also use this space to highlight your collections like metal wall decorations, wall sculptures or many others. If you are blessed with talent in making art, paint your wall accordingly. Make it as your canvas and fill them with colors.

Lighting is also very important for your room. You may want to have options on illuminating it. Lighting conditions should be flexible so that when you need it for reading or other activities, it should sufficient to help you see what you are doing. You should also have lighting options that can be very conducive for sleeping. Never miss putting drapes on your windows. This way if you want to have a quick nap in the middle of the day, you keep the light entering in your room at a minimum.

Put furniture that you are only needed especially when you have such a small space. What you are trying to avoid in here is getting the place to look overcrowded. Make sure that in anything that you put inside is useful. If not, the hallow spaces of the unused furniture may just keep on accumulating dust.

Keep your things tidy enough. Organize your clothing and keep them where they should be placed. If you decide to clean the place up, include you wall and the items on it such as the metal wall decorations. If you clean the top of the cabinet, include what is under it. Things that you have outgrown should be placed on the storage room or in the basement.

Lastly, you can try to put flowers in your room or some plants by the window just to have a sprinkle of nature in your room. Open your windows at times to keep fresh air coming in. This is a great way to ventilate your room.
